   3. Visit Dorking Museum & Heritage Centre: Dive into Local History! Next, immerse yourself in local history at the Dorking Museum & Heritage Centre. This small but fascinating museum showcases the town's rich history, from its Roman origins to its development as a market town.    5. Lunchtime visit to Denbies Wine Estate: For lunch, head off out to Denbies Wine Estate, England's largest vineyard. If you’re hungry, The Gallery Restaurant, offers stunning views of the vineyard. The menu features locally sourced ingredients and seasonal dishes. After lunch, you can take a short walk around the vineyard or join a guided tour to learn about winemaking and sample some local wines.    6. Explore Box Hill: After you’ve finished at Denbies, head to Box Hill, part of the Surrey Hills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. Whether you choose a leisurely walk or a more challenging hike, the stunning views over the North Downs are not to be missed. There are several well-marked trails, including the famous Stepping Stones Walk.

   8. Visit St. Martin's Church: Take a moment to visit St. Martin's Church, an impressive Victorian Gothic structure. The church's beautiful architecture, stained glass windows, and peaceful atmosphere make it a lovely spot for quiet reflection and admiration.
